হার্ড ড্রাইভের ঘুমের সময় নির্ধারণ (7 দিন) করা কি সম্ভব?


9

যখন আমার লিনাক্সের সাথে যুক্ত কোনও বহিরাগত হার্ড ড্রাইভ (ডিবিয়ান 9) বাক্সটি ঘুমাতে যায় (স্পিনিং বন্ধ করে) তখন আমি নির্ধারিত হওয়ার একটি উপায় খুঁজছি।

এটি সামগ্রীতে রাখার জন্য: আমার কাছে একটি লিনাক্স বক্স রয়েছে যা মাল্টিমিডিয়া সার্ভার হিসাবে চলে। যদি কোনও বাহ্যিক হার্ড ড্রাইভে থাকা সামগ্রীগুলি আনতে কল করা হয়, তবে হার্ড ড্রাইভটি উঠতে এবং ঘুরতে শুরু করতে প্রায় 15-30 সেকেন্ড সময় লাগে যা ক) হতাশাজনক এবং খ) কখনও কখনও মাল্টিমিডিয়া সার্ভারের সাথে টাইমআউট করে outs আমি 24/7 জেগে ও কাটানোর জন্য হার্ড ড্রাইভটি সেট করতে পারতাম, তবে এটি যখন আমি বাসায় থাকি তখন বেশিরভাগ সময় আমি কেবল মাল্টিমিডিয়া সার্ভার ব্যবহার করি a

হার্ড ড্রাইভ স্পিনিংয়ের সময় সাপ্তাহিক সময়সূচী সেট করার জন্য আমি কি কোনও সফ্টওয়্যার সরঞ্জাম বা কমান্ড ব্যবহার করতে পারি - যেমন সোমবার-শুক্রবার: শনিবার-রবিবার সন্ধ্যা 11 টা থেকে রাত ১১ টার মধ্যে স্পিনিং: বেলা তিনটা থেকে রাত ১১ টার মধ্যে স্পিনিং অন্যভাবে চাহিদা অনুযায়ী ঘুমান এবং ঘুমান সিস্টেম টাইমার


1
সুতরাং আপনি ডিস্ক চালানোর সময় হ্রাস করছেন, কিন্তু সপ্তাহে 40 বার আপনার ডিস্ক শুরু / বন্ধ করছেন। ডিস্ক শুরু করা বা থামানো তার ব্যয় ছাড়াই নয়। আপনি যেখানে থাকেন সেখানে বিদ্যুৎ ব্যয়বহুল না হলে এটি চেষ্টা করার মতো নাও হতে পারে।
ওয়ালটিনেটর

1
@ ওয়াল্টিনেটর মডার্ন এইচডিডি কয়েক হাজার স্টার্ট-স্টপ চক্র পরিচালনা করার জন্য ডিজাইন করা হয়েছে, সুতরাং প্রতিদিন একটি চক্র থাকা একেবারেই ক্ষতিকারক নয়। এই হারে অতিরিক্ত সংখ্যক স্পিন-ডাউনগুলি থেকে এইচডিডি মারতে আক্ষরিকভাবে এক হাজার বছর সময় লাগবে। যদি কিছু হয় তবে আমি কয়েক ঘন্টা অব্যর্থ কাটনা সম্পর্কে আরও উদ্বিগ্ন।
দিমিত্রি গ্রিগরিয়েভ

@ ওয়াল্টিনেটর ফেয়ার আর্গুমেন্ট, তবে পুরো কথাটি হ'ল এর ফলে স্পিন উত্স / ডাউনগুলিতে প্রকৃতই নেট ডিসেক্রেস হয়ে উঠবে, যেমনটি প্রতি মুহূর্তে মাল্টিমিডিয়া সার্ভারের কাছ থেকে কমপক্ষে কম স্প্যানিশ স্পষ্ট হয় এবং বিশেষত: আমি সময়সূচী চাই। আপনি যেমনটি বলেছিলেন, প্রতিবার ড্রাইভ স্পিনে আসার সময় এটি সম্ভবত আরও বেশি শক্তি ব্যয় করে - তাই সন্ধ্যায় এটিকে ঘুরানো ছেড়ে দেওয়া সম্ভবত শক্তির ব্যবহার বন্ধ করে দেবে।
অ্যালেক্স ওয়ার্ড

উত্তর:


17

একটি ক্রোনজব এটি অনুমতি দেয়:

# At 11pm every day, enable sleep after 30s
0 23 * * * /sbin/hdparm -S6 /dev/disk/by-id/...

# At 5pm on weekdays, disable sleeping
0 17 * * 1-5 /sbin/hdparm -S0 /dev/disk/by-id/...

# At 3pm on the weekend, disable sleeping
0 15 * * 0,6 /sbin/hdparm -S0 /dev/disk/by-id/...
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.